Output e9044440c260ea72a39b8d8ceec8d5f887cbf0b8e84be03a61f44990e5ecf6f9:2

value
27670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69c907dba6512caa09633c9937e359c9040f195f OP_EQUAL
address
MHYW1RtfQhgyLQtXYd6Zfv1SCZp4PYcejA
transaction
e9044440c260ea72a39b8d8ceec8d5f887cbf0b8e84be03a61f44990e5ecf6f9
spent
true